Who is directly responsible for ensuring compliance with the storm water management measures?

The Industrial Storm Water Certified Operator is directly responsible for ensuring compliance with the storm water management measures. This role is critical because the certified operator has specialized training and knowledge regarding the regulations, best practices, and procedures necessary to manage storm water in an industrial context effectively.

In addition, the certified operator plays a key role in implementing and maintaining the storm water management program, which includes monitoring activities, conducting inspections, and ensuring that practices align with the permit requirements set forth by regulatory agencies. This responsibility encompasses the understanding of how industrial operations can impact water quality and the environment, making it essential for the operator to take direct action to mitigate these risks.

By being at the forefront of storm water management within the facility, the certified operator facilitates compliance not only with local laws and regulations but also with environmental stewardship initiatives, ultimately contributing to the overall sustainability goals of the industrial facility.
